#9e7d50 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9e7d50 is composed of 62% red, 49%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 20.9% magenta, 49.4%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 34.6 degrees, a saturation of 32.8% and a lightness of 46.7%. #9e7d50 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ffaa0 with #3d0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

#9e7d50 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9e7d50 has RGB values of R:158, G:125, B:80 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.21, Y:0.49,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 10386768.
